In addition, it is sometimes … Web3 feb. 2014 · Metformin is absorbed throughout the gastrointestinal tract with an oral bioavailability of 50–60%. It is extensively distributed to the tissues. Metformin does not significantly bind to plasma proteins and reaches a steady state in 24–48 hours. The plasma half-life is around 3.5 hours.
